Famed tonkotsu ramen chain where you customise every detail of your bowl in a private booth for the ultimate solo dining experience.
ICHIRAN is one of Japan's most iconic ramen brands, and its Harajuku outpost draws ramen devotees from across the globe. The restaurant is best known for its rich, creamy tonkotsu broth and a uniquely personal ordering system: you fill in a preference sheet specifying everything from noodle firmness and soup richness to garlic intensity and spice level.The signature 'booth seating' arrangement means each diner enjoys their bowl in a private partition, free from distraction — a concept ICHIRAN calls 'flavour concentration'. If you'd like a refill, simply press a button and another serving of noodles arrives without breaking the flow. It's an experience that feels both meditative and wonderfully indulgent.
The Harajuku branch is handily located just off the main drag and tends to draw long queues, especially at weekends and during evenings, so visiting outside peak hours is wise. Ordering is available in English, and the process is reassuringly straightforward even for first-timers. Cash and card are both accepted.
